けいせん
noun
ruled line, grid line
1. ruled line, grid line
Lines printed or drawn on paper to guide writing, or lines used in tables and spreadsheets. Refers to both horizontal and vertical ruling lines.
罫線(けいせん)沿()って()く。
Write along the ruled lines.
この用紙(ようし)には罫線(けいせん)()いてある。
This paper has ruled lines on it.
エクセルの(ひょう)罫線(けいせん)追加(ついか)して()やすくした。
I added grid lines to the Excel table to make it easier to read.

USAGE:
Used for both physical ruled lines on paper and digital grid lines in spreadsheets and documents. In office and computing contexts, adding or removing 罫線(けいせん) is a common formatting task.

WORD FORMATION:
(けい) (ruled line, square) + (せん) (line).

COMMON COLLOCATIONS:

  • 罫線(けいせん)()く: draw ruled lines
  • 罫線(けいせん)()り: with ruled lines, lined
  • 罫線(けいせん)沿()って: along the ruled lines
  • 罫線(けいせん)追加(ついか)する: add grid lines
